Methane dry reforming with carbon dioxide is a highly endothermic reaction that can be used for carbon dioxide and methane consumption and for the production of syngas. However, it is expedient to examine how the CO 2 can be captured and store for subsequent utilization in dry … WebJun 6, 2024 · The conventional reforming processes are mainly known as steam reforming (SR), partial oxidation reforming (POR), auto-thermal reforming (ATR), dry reforming (DR), and dry oxidation reforming (DOR).
